Output 238b45f28e1a53d786e25df4ef91396452c049ac34d5aee0131ace0daeb96c62:37

value
19726626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 230b23a1ea08323baa92dab773e0e904ad120849 OP_EQUAL
address
MB6TE7FuzPwLWzAPGzFRbRzeJbgds4A6zN
transaction
238b45f28e1a53d786e25df4ef91396452c049ac34d5aee0131ace0daeb96c62
spent
true